Description:
*Domain:*
JAVA_OPTS is not passed to PC and HC JVMs in domain.ps1
Steps to reproduce:
# start powershell
# $env:JAVA_OPTS = "-Da=b"
# ./domain.bat
# WMIC PROCESS get Commandline | findstr java
# check that "a" property is present in PC or HC
# exit domain.bat
# ./domain.ps1
# WMIC PROCESS get Commandline | findstr java
# check that "a" property is *not* present in PC or HC
cc: [~jamezp]
----
*Standalone:*
PRESERVE_JAVA_OPTS parameter is not used correctly in standalone.conf.ps1 and
standalone.ps1. If user define JAVA_OPTS, default JAVA_OPTS should be ignored (like bat
scripts behaviour)
